Maraca Sleeves for Samba De Amigo?

By Jorge Ba-oh 16.05.2008 3

Sega may produce maraca sleeves to fit in with the upcoming release of Samba De Amigo.

Samba De Amigo sees players shaking their Wii-remotes and nunchucks to simulate maraca movement in time to some funky beats.

Speaking to Kotaku, the company confirmed that they have been looking into producing sleeves make the experience even more realistic, and have spoken to various manufacturers about it.

The team also confirmed that records can be posted to an online leaderboard.
